Transvenous Lead Removal Post-Market Clinical Study

Purpose

This prospective, multicenter, post-market clinical study was designed to evaluate the outcomes of lead extraction of cardiovascular implantable electronic devices (CIED) using Cook catheter and lead extraction devices for any indication it is used in the commercial setting within the United States and Europe. The purpose of this clinical study is to collect data on the performance of the Cook lead extraction devices for the purpose of supporting publications and presentations

Inclusion Criteria

  1. Patients must be 18 years of age or older 2. Lead indwell time greater than 1 year

Exclusion Criteria

  1. Patient is unable or unwilling to provide informed consent (per the IRB/EC requirements) to participate in the clinical study 2. Patient presents with an extracardiac lead

Arm Groups

ArmDescriptionAssigned Intervention
Cook lead extraction devices The Cook lead extraction devices are indicated for use in patients requiring percutaneous removal of CIED leads, indwelling catheters and foreign objects.
  • Device: Cook lead extraction devices
    The Cook lead extraction devices are mechanical devices that encompass a full variety of devices required for percutaneous removal of CIED leads, indwelling catheters and foreign objects.
